37, ASHLEY ROAD, LONDON, N19 3AG - £1,850,000

37 ASHLEY ROAD is a very large extended detached house of 242m², built sometime before 1900. It was last sold for £1,850,000 in August 2014, which was around 20% above the average August 2014 detached price in the Islington local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2014,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was C.

37 ASHLEY 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Islington local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 37 ASHLEY ROAD sales from July 1999 and August 2014 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 1999 sale was for 15%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 15% above the HPI over time, until the August 2014 sale, where it rises to 20%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 20% above the HPI.

37 ASHLEY ROAD: Plot and Title Map

37 ASHLEY 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.094 of an acre, or 382m². The below map shows the location of 37 ASHLEY 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 37 ASHLEY 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
